Which spa hotels in Georgia are best for couples?
Lopota Lake Resort & Spa and Crystal Hotel & Spa are highly recommended for couples, offering romantic packages and private settings, along with amenities like couples' treatments and scenic views over the lakes and mountains.
Are there family-friendly spa hotels in Georgia?
Yes, hotels like Borjomi Palace Health & Spa Center and Urban Park Hotels provide family-friendly amenities such as spacious rooms, children's pools, and wellness activities suitable for all ages.
Which spa hotels offer stunning views?
Kobuleti Georgia Palace Hotel & Spa and Mountain Resort Gantiadi provide remarkable views of the Black Sea and surrounding mountains, ideal for scenic relaxation.
What are some of the cheapest spa hotel options in Georgia?
The Apart View Hotel & Spa often offers competitive rates starting as low as $60 per night during the off-peak season, making it one of the more affordable spa options available.
Which is the top-rated spa hotel in Georgia based on guest reviews?
Borjomi Likani Health & Spa Centre is frequently rated as the top spa hotel, known for its exceptional service and extensive wellness programs, receiving a satisfaction score of 9.2 out of 10 from guests.
